Campsite #8 Features: Drive-In access, Back-In parking, 40ft driveway, Fire ring, Picnic Table, RV Site, Tent Site, Trailer Site, Pets Allowed

@StephanieG691 · Camped on Jul 2, 2021 at Campsite #8
Had a great time at Red Bridge Campground over July 4th weekend 2021. We had campsite 8, with lovely river access (though the water level was so low that there was just an ankle-deep pool to splash in right next to the campsite, with the main body of the river a few hundred feet away. There is unfortunately nothing between campsites 8 and 7 for visual privacy (really wish there were some bushes or something), but they're quite a ways apart, so it wasn't a huge deal. The site on the other side was closer but had bushes as a visual screen. Also no trees appropriate for hanging a hammock at site 8 (all either too far apart or too close together). Someone far in the distance (not even sure if it was within the campground) was playing music at night, but it was faint at our site (I wore earplugs to block it out, and it didn't bother my kids at all), and I was pleased that everyone seemed to be respecting the ban on fireworks. My kids (4yo and 7yo) and I had a FABULOUS time exploring the river bed and walking across the giant fallen tree to the other side of the river (it's so big it's practically like walking on a sidewalk). The tent pad was huge (I'm guessing 10ft x 16ft?), and the bathrooms were clean and stocked with toilet paper. No firewood for sale at this site, but we were able to get some at Verlot campground (about 7mi away?). We'll be back sometime!
